### Step 4: Configure the renderer

The Inkmere markdown pipeline converts docs to HTML via the sandboxed renderer pods. Before promoting a release, set `RENDER_CONCURRENCY=8` and confirm the sanitizer ruleset version matches the one tagged in the release notes. The renderer fetches embedded assets from the Coldbay cache, which rejects unsigned requests. Signing is handled by a key read from the environment at pod start, so the env file must include it. Add the cache signing key on the following line.

vault entry, kagep-yajeg: COURIER_KEY5=da097

Ticket: Drift on Plowline telemetry gateway

Hey — flagging for the release manager. The Plowline gateway boxes out at the Dairen test farm have drifted from what's in the release manifest; someone hand-tweaked buffer sizes and the upload interval during the harvest crunch and never backported it. Fleet now disagrees with the repo, so the next release will stomp the field fixes. We need a decision before Thursday. The values currently running on the fleet are below.

service settings:
PRAIX_LOG_LEVEL=error
PRAIX_METRICS_HOST=metrics.praix.qorvelcorp.corp
PRAIX_POOL_SIZE=16

Welcome to the Striderlap timing team! Our chip reader, the PaceGate unit, picks up runner chips at each mat and streams splits to the scoring service. For your security review: readers sit on an isolated VLAN and only talk outbound. Each unit authenticates with a device secret, set in its env file on the next line.

vault entry, yahif-yajep: COURIER_KEY29=b802bdf8034096b65a51c6ba5abe2

To future maintainers of the Emberline loyalty-points ledger: as of this quarter, responsibility for ledger reconciliation, the double-entry validation jobs, and the nightly balance snapshots has formally transferred. Please note that the migration scripts under the Quillhaven repo remain frozen until the audit completes; do not modify them without explicit approval. For any discrepancy in point accrual or redemption totals, contact the newly designated owner named below.

approver of tagef-hawef = Oliok Julath